修正:Windowsシェル共通DLLが機能しなくなった



問題を排除するために楽器を試してください

DLLファイルには、Windowsの他のプログラムが日常的に使用するデータと関数のセットが含まれています。たとえば、Windowsで操作するダイアログボックスは、Comdlg32DLLファイルのさまざまな機能を使用します。 Windowsのすべてのプロセスは、いずれかの方法でDLLに依存しています。ザ・ Windowsシェル共通DLLが応答していません ここで解決するエラーは、何らかのエラーが原因でWindowsシェル共通DLLがクラッシュしたことを示しています。このメッセージを示す小さなダイアログボックスが表示されます。そのダイアログボックスからオンラインでソリューションを確認するか、そのダイアログボックスを閉じることができます。多くのユーザーにとって、このエラーが二度と表示されない場合がありますが、Windowsで特定の変更を行おうとするたびに発生する、日常的な問題になる場合もあります。



Windowsシェル共通DLLが動作を停止しました



このクラッシュの前に、通常、ユーザーがオーディオデバイス(再生デバイスまたは録音デバイス)の構成を変更しようとします。 [構成]ダイアログボックスは正常に開く場合がありますが、その中をクリックすると、Windowsシェル共通DLLが応答していませんというエラーが表示され、構成ウィンドウが閉じます。



その構成ウィンドウはオーディオデバイスのドライバーに直接アクセスするため、そのドライバーが破損しているか、Windowsの動作と互換性がない場合、DLLプロセスがクラッシュし、エラーが発生する可能性があります。ほとんどのユーザーにとって、エラーは数回のインスタンスの後に消えましたが、残りのユーザーについては、このエラーに対して機能することが知られている解決策を以下に示します。

破損したシステムファイルを修復する

Restoroをダウンロードして実行し、破損したファイルや不足しているファイルをスキャンして復元します。 ここに 、完了したら、以下の解決策に進みます。以下の解決策に進む前に、すべてのシステムファイルが無傷で破損していないことを確認することが重要です。

解決策1:適切なドライバーをインストールする

互換性のないオーディオデバイスドライバーは、Windows7以降のオペレーティングシステムが従う方法に対して動作することが知られています。したがって、ベータ版ではなく、安定版のドライバーを使用していることを確認する必要があります。ご使用のオペレーティングシステム用の以前のバージョンのドライバーをコンピューターモデルの製造元のWebサイトからダウンロードし、デバイスマネージャーからインストールできます。



オーディオデバイスが古い場合、新しいオペレーティングシステムのドライバーが利用できない場合は、代わりにMicrosoftVistaのドライバーを試すこともできます。コンピュータモデルの製造元のWebサイトからもダウンロードできます。

それらをインストールするには、 押す そして ホールド インクルード ウィンドウズ キーと Rを押す 。タイプ devmgmt.msc [実行]ダイアログボックスで、を押します 入る

開いた[デバイス管理]ウィンドウで、 ダブルクリック オン サウンド、ビデオ、ゲームコントローラー

それの下に、 右クリック オン ハイデフィニションオーディオ をクリックします ドライバーソフトウェアの更新 ポップアップメニューから。

クリック コンピューターを参照してドライバーソフトウェアを探す ドライバーをダウンロードした場所に移動します。ドライバを選択し、画面の指示に進みます。

ドライバがない場合は、システムの製造元のサイトでドライバを確認する必要があります。通常、モデル番号を入力して、ドライバーをダウンロードできる製造元のサイトでシステム構成を取得します。

USBヘッドフォンを接続しようとしたときにこのエラーが表示された場合は、この問題を解決することがわかっているので、USB3.0ドライバーに挿入してみてください。

解決策2:オーディオ効果を無効にする

ドライバーの非互換性のため、オーディオに何らかの効果を適用した場合、たとえばイコライザーのモードを変更した場合、これもWindowsシェルの一般的なエラーの原因となる可能性があります。

これらのオーディオエフェクトがすべてオフになっていることを確認してください。また、エンハンストオーディオなどに類似した機能をすべてオフにします。

解決策3:SFCスキャンを実行する

このスキャンは、すべてのDLLを含む重要なWindowsファイルの整合性をチェックします。手順に従ってください ここに SFCスキャンを実行します。

解決策4:証明書を受け入れるようにWindowsを構成する

多くのWindowsユーザーの場合、コンピューターはデフォルトですべての証明書をブロックするように構成されています。 Windowsは、ユーザーだけでなく、インストールされているデバイスやドライバーのIDを確認するために、証明書に大きく依存しています。その場合、すべての証明書をブロックするようにWindowsが構成されていると、オペレーティングシステムが特定のデバイス(再生デバイスや記録デバイスなど)やそのドライバーのIDを確認できなくなり、ユーザーが Windowsシェル共通DLLが動作を停止しました 影響を受けるデバイスの設定を調整しようとすると、エラーメッセージが表示されます。

その場合は、 Windows PowerShell すべてではないにしても一部の証明書を受け入れるようにWindowsを構成すると、この問題を解決できるはずです。このソリューションを使用するには、次のことを行う必要があります。

  1. を開きます スタートメニュー
  2. 検索する ' パワーシェル 」。
  3. タイトルの検索結果を右クリックします Windows PowerShell をクリックします 管理者として実行 コンテキストメニューで。
  4. 次のように入力します Windows PowerShell を押して 入る
 Set-ExecutionPolicy -ExecutionPolicy Unrestricted -Scope CurrentUser 
  1. コマンドが実行されたら、閉じます Windows PowerShell そして 再起動 あなたのコンピュータ。

コンピュータが起動したら、問題が修正されているかどうかを確認してください。

解決策5:クリーンブートの実行

サードパーティのアプリケーションまたはサービスがオペレーティングシステムの特定の要素に干渉している可能性があるため、この手順では、クリーンブートを実行して、このエラーの原因となっているアプリケーション/サービスを特定します。そのために:

  1. ログ 管理者アカウントを持つコンピューターに。
  2. 押す ' ウィンドウズ 「+」 R 」から 開いた実行 ' 促す。

    実行プロンプトを開く

  3. タイプmsconfig 」と 押す 「」 入る '。

    MSCONFIGの実行

  4. クリックサービス 」オプションと チェックを外します隠す すべて マイクロソフト サービス 」ボタン。

    [サービス]タブをクリックし、[すべてのMicrosoftサービスを非表示にする]オプションのチェックを外します

  5. クリック無効にする すべて 」オプション、次に「 OK '。

    「すべて無効にする」オプションをクリックする

  6. クリック起動 」タブと クリック開いた 仕事 マネージャー 」オプション。

    「タスクマネージャを開く」オプションをクリックする

  7. クリック起動 タスクマネージャの「」ボタン。
  8. クリック いずれか 応用 リストに「 有効 その横に書かれた」と 選択する無効にする 」オプション。

    「スタートアップ」タブをクリックし、そこにリストされているアプリケーションを選択します

  9. 繰り返す リスト内のすべてのアプリケーションに対するこのプロセスと 再起動 あなたのコンピュータ。
  10. これで、コンピュータは「 掃除 ブート 」状態。
  11. 小切手 問題が解決するかどうかを確認します。
  12. エラーが発生しなくなった場合は、開始します 有効にする インクルード サービス 1 沿って 1 そして 識別する インクルード サービス 沿って 有効にする これは エラー 来る バック
  13. どちらか、 再インストール サービスまたは 保つ それ 無効

解決策6:Synapticsタッチパッドドライバーの再インストール

Synaptic Touchpadドライバーは、「Windowsシェル共通DLLが動作を停止しました」というエラーを引き起こすことがあることが知られています。したがって、このステップでは、ドライバーを再インストールします。そのために:

  1. 押す ' ウィンドウズ 「+」 R 」ボタンを同時に開いて 実行 促す

    実行プロンプトを開く

  2. devmgmtmsc 」を押して「 入る '。

    実行プロンプトで「devmgmt.msc」と入力します。

  3. ダブル クリック'マウス そして その他 ポインティング デバイス 」ドロップダウンと 正しい - クリックシナプティクス タッチパッド ' 運転者。

    Synapticsタッチパッドドライバーを右クリック

  4. 選択する 「」 アンインストール 」をクリックし、「 はい プロンプトで」。

    リストから「デバイスのアンインストール」オプションを選択する

  5. フォローする 完全に画面上の指示 アンインストール ドライバ。
  6. ナビゲート デバイス管理ウィンドウに戻り、 クリック行動 上部の「」タブ。
  7. 選択する 「」 ハードウェアの変更をスキャンする リストから」を選択して、ドライバを再インストールします。

    リストから「ハードウェアの変更をスキャン」を選択する

  8. 小切手 問題が解決しないかどうかを確認します。
読んだ5分